What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as an RFP specialist?

To thrive as an RFP Specialist, you need strong writing, project management, and analytical skills, often supported by a bachelor’s degree in business, communications, or a related field. Familiarity with RFP management software like RFPIO, Loopio, or Qvidian, and experience with CRM and document collaboration tools is typically required. Attention to detail, time management, and the ability to collaborate across departments are crucial soft skills in this role. These competencies ensure the timely delivery of compelling proposals that meet client requirements and help organizations win new business.

What is an RFP?

RFP stands for 'Request for Proposal.' It is a formal document that organizations use to solicit bids from vendors or service providers for a specific project or procurement. RFPs outline the requirements, scope of work, evaluation criteria, and submission instructions to ensure potential vendors understand what is needed. Responding to an RFP allows vendors to present their solutions and pricing, helping the issuing organization select the best fit for their needs.

What are common challenges faced by professionals working in RFP management, and how can they overcome them?

RFP professionals often face challenges such as tight deadlines, coordinating input from multiple departments, and ensuring proposal compliance with client requirements. To overcome these challenges, strong project management skills and clear communication are essential. Many teams use proposal management software and standardized templates to streamline collaboration and increase efficiency. Building good relationships with subject matter experts also helps ensure timely and accurate information for proposals.

Job Responsibilities

Purchases goods, materials, components, or services in line with specified cost, quality, and delivery targets.

Completes purchase requests with domestic and international suppliers by inputting purchase orders, expediting deliveries, and verifying all transactions.

Handles over-shipments, delivery shortages, changes in quantity, delivery dates, and prices and reports such changes to impacted parties promptly.

Authorizes payment for purchases by reviewing invoices and related documentation.

Monitors supplier performance by ensuring that product is delivered as scheduled and meets specifications; maintaining appropriate files and records of meetings with suppliers to ensure company requirements are met and that supplier is aware of their performance.

Issues requests for quotes/proposals (RFQ/RFP) and supports decision-making to select the best source consistent with cost, quality, and delivery requirements.

Reviews all available reports for shortages and excess and takes appropriate action to expedite or disposition material.

Conducts supplier performance review and business plan review with strategic suppliers for leverage and future planning.

Implements and drives continuous improvement activities through the application of change management and best practices.

Maintains supplier relationships to drive cost reductions while achieving the highest level of quality material and ensuring open communication, including sharing demand forecasts.

Performs additional duties as assigned.
